Resumo:
Unplanned urban growth has caused severe impacts on urban rivers, such as water quality degradation, silting and removal of riparian vegetation. Such impacts can, in the long term, interfere with the perception of the population and public authorities in relation to the water resource, which is treated as “sewage”. The Igarapé do Juá watershed, located in the city of Santarém, underwent a rapid process of urbanization in the first decades of the 2000s, which resulted in the conversion of a natural watercourse into “sewer” according to the perception of local public and private agents and the population that lives in its surroundings. This work presents results which show that most of the interviewees did not know the Juá stream; 88% of the participants did not know what riparian forest is; and 33% of those questioned referred to the stream as a sewer. Based on these results, an Environmental Education action was formulated, adequate to the reality of the area and that can serve as an instrument for changing perceptions and improving environmental conditions.
